Ingredients

1 medium onion , diced
1 1/2 cups uncooked quinoa
1 1/4 cups broth
1 1/2 lbs stew beef chunks
1 red bell pepper , sliced
1 1/3 cups milk ( skim , 1 % , 2 % whole all work )
1/3 cup peanut butter ( crunchy or smooth )
6 garlic cloves
1 teaspoon cayenne pepper
1 teaspoon salt ( to taste )
2 cans diced tomatoes
1 sweet potato , 1/2 inch cubes
10 ounces frozen spinach
African Peanut Butter Stew, also known as Mafe, is a traditional West African recipe that has been enjoyed for centuries. The dish is popular in countries such as Senegal, Ghana, and Mali, where it is often made with a blend of peanut butter, vegetables, and meat. This recipe is a hearty and wholesome version of the classic dish. The combination of sweet potatoes, quinoa, and stew beef makes it a filling and satisfying meal that is perfect for a chilly evening. The dish is also high in protein, fiber, and other essential nutrients, making it a healthy choice for any occasion.

Instructions

1.Heat a large pot over medium-high heat. Add the onions and sauté until they are translucent.
2.Add the stew beef chunks and brown until they are well-seared.
3.Stir in the peanut butter, garlic, salt, and cayenne pepper until everything is well combined.
4.Add the sweet potato cubes, diced tomatoes, and red bell pepper slices and stir to combine.
5.Add the uncooked quinoa and broth, bring the mixture to a boil, and then turn the heat down.
6.Let the mixture simmer for about 20 minutes or until the sweet potatoes and quinoa are tender.
7.Add the frozen spinach and milk and let the mixture simmer for another 5 minutes or until the spinach is heated through.

HEALTH & BENEFITS

The African Peanut Butter Stew is packed with nutrients that are essential for good health.
The stew beef provides protein and zinc, while the sweet potatoes offer vitamin A and fiber.
The quinoa adds extra protein and fiber, and the spinach is a great source of iron, calcium, and vitamin K. Peanuts also offer a source of healthy fats, protein, and fiber.
